Russian Strike Eliminates Aidar Unit with Long-Range FABs

© Минобороны России / t.me/mod_russia

Russian forces eliminated an Aidar unit near Vozdvizhevka using long-range FABs, as Moscow expands production of high-explosive bombs beyond 200 km range.

Russian aviation has eliminated a unit of the Aidar* militant formation that was recently redeployed to the boundary between the Dnepropetrovsk and Zaporizhzhia regions, advisor to the head of the Donetsk People’s Republic Igor Kimakovsky told TASS.

He said that Russian forces struck a concentration of fighters near the village of Vozdvizhevka using high-explosive aerial bombs (FABs), destroying up to ten members of the group.

Reports surfaced on November 28 indicating that Aidar* personnel had been moved into the border area between the two regions.

Forbes previously noted that Russia is rapidly boosting production of one of its most powerful munitions — high-explosive aerial bombs capable of hitting targets at distances of up to 200 kilometers, more than double their earlier range. According to the publication, the Russian Aerospace Forces now deploy large quantities of FABs on a daily basis, and Ukraine’s air-defense systems are unable to intercept them.
